Proven energy companies are collaborating with startups to bring advanced geothermal technology to utility scale, with the goal of supplying U.S. military bases with reliable and cost-effective electricity, even during grid outages
-
Program will explore how to tap into America’s abundant geothermal energy supply to increase national security
-
Solution could provide utility-scale, 5-megawatt energy resilience, 24-7 at about 50 DoD sites in the western U.S. and along the western Gulf of America
NISKAYUNA, NY (March 12, 2025) – GE Vernova Inc. (NYSE: GEV) in collaboration with Energy System Group (ESG), Sage Geosystems (Sage), The Energy & Geoscience Institute at The University of Utah (EGI), announced that they were selected by U.S. Air Force and the Department of Defense’s Chief Digital and Artificial Intelligence Office (CDAO) to explore how to tap into America’s abundant geothermal energy supply to increase our national security.
This team, which has achieved "Awardable" status, is led by ESG. With over 30 years of experience working on military bases to provide power security and advanced mission readiness, Energy Systems Group will take the lead in designing power plants at Department of Defense (DoD) installations and developing a robust business model for each project. The team is strengthened by GE Vernova’s contributions from its Advanced Research, Power Conversion & Storage, and Grid Solutions businesses, which bring cutting-edge power conversion and microgrid technology, as well as battery energy storage systems integration (BESS).
The team is also supported by the Energy & Geoscience Institute at The University of Utah (EGI), which brings over 30 years of experience in geothermal resource exploration and characterization. Additionally, Sage will contribute its patented, proven pressure geothermal system, which operates like a multi-cylinder engine, utilizing two wells in an injection and production pattern to maximize efficiency and sustainability.
With this expertise, the team is now poised to explore the development of utility-scale geothermal power plants in the United States and abroad, with the goal of supplying U.S. military bases with reliable and cost-effective electricity, even during grid outages. This team was selected through the CDAO’s innovative solicitation process known as the Tradewinds Solutions Marketplace, which is designed to accelerate the procurement and adoption of mission critical technologies, such as Artificial Intelligence, Machine Learning, and resilient energy technologies.
“The U.S. Air Force leveraged the Tradewinds solicitation process to quickly collaborate with innovative American companies to build resilient, next-generation geothermal technologies at our bases, using private capital instead of taxpayer dollars,” said Mr. Kirk Phillips, Director, Air Force Office of Energy Assurance.”
GE Vernova's video, “GEO2X,” or “Advanced Geothermal Energy-to-Everything,” accessible only by government customers on the Tradewinds Solutions Marketplace, presents a solution that could provide 5-megawatt energy resilience 24-7 at about 50 DoD sites along the western Gulf of America and to the west of 101 degrees longitude. The solution includes geothermal assessment expertise (EGI and Sage), drilling (Sage), power conversion, delivery, microgrid design and control (GE Vernova), hydrogen generation and storage (GE Vernova), and power generation and project development (Energy System Group).

About Sage Geosystems
Sage Geosystems is a leader in the next-generation geothermal industry, pioneering the use of Pressure Geothermal. Pressure Geothermal leverages both the heat and the pressure of the earth to enable three applications: energy storage, power generation and district heating. About The Energy & Geoscience Institute at The University of Utah
The Energy & Geoscience Institute (EGI) is a multidisciplinary energy institute at the University of Utah. Over its 50-plus year existence, EGI has performed groundbreaking petroleum and geothermal exploration research around the world and has worked on innovative geothermal technologies. EGI manages FORGE (Frontier Observatory for Research in Geothermal Energy), a U.S. Department of Energy flagship project.
